Horseback Riding – Golden Isles Carriage and Trail at Three Oaks FarmOffers family-friendly activities including horseback riding on Driftwood Beach, narrated horse-drawn carriage tours of the Historic District, and a large petting zoo. Camps, events, rentals, and wedding carriage services are also available. Multiple Jekyll Island locations:
    100 Stable Rd. (daytime carriage tours)
    Latitude 31 (evening carriage tours)
    Clam Creek Rd. (beach rides)Hours: Open Tues-Sun; please call for hours. Website: threeoaksfarm.org Phone: 912.635.9500

Visit Tidelands 4h Center Tidelands offers kayak tours, coastal ecology programs, Island nature walks, and summer and school group programs as well as an exhibit gallery featuring live coastal species, including sea turtles, fish, invertebrates, horseshoe crabs, snakes, alligators, and more.Hours: Mon-Fri: 9 a.m.-4 p.m. | Sat-Sun: 10 a.m.-2 p.m.Location: 100 S. Riverview Dr. Website: tidelands4h.org Phone: 912.635.5032
